An Innovative 3-phase Design of Multilevel Converter for Renewable Energy Applications
Main Article Content
Abstract
In this paper a new three phase symmetrical multilevel converter for grid connected system using PV source. The renewable energy sources are application of the distributed generation (DG) in the distribution system acquired more attention. The Distribution generation systems are powered by micro sources such as fuel cells, photovoltaic (PV) systems, and batteries. PV distributed system in which the solar source is low dc input voltage interfaced to grid using front-end conversion. Three phase Cascaded H-Bridge Seven level inverter is interfaced with low frequency transformer with multiplePV Source is proposed. Nowadays multilevel inverter (MLI) plays a vital role in the field of power electronics and being widely used in many industrial and commercial applications. Moreover the advantages like high quality power output, low switching losses, low electro-magnetic interference (EMI) and high output voltage made multilevel inverter as a powerful solution in converter topology.
